NOTE Turn the power on/off in right order.
•Power on the projector before the computer or video tape recorder.
•Power off the projector after the computer or video tape recorder.
3 Press the STANDBY/ON button (control panel or remote control)
•The projector begins warming up and the POWER indicator blinks green.
